Output 51298143a43b09024f4cce68205630a23a349916681c451ae41313054413a0ba:0

value
7455467980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d856d27f3493dbb1ff305bc0facdeccadd924b3 OP_EQUALVERIFY OP_CHECKSIG
address
DPsnuDEsUNhTrXRmZM5b5vuGneyyhEQVKD
transaction
51298143a43b09024f4cce68205630a23a349916681c451ae41313054413a0ba